RMS Olympic and Thomas Sopwith. New York, 1911
As the RMS Olympic leaves New York Harbor, Thomas Sopwith, flying a modified Wright/Sopwith biplane, attempts to drop a package on board from the air. After aborting the first approach due to gusty winds, he dropped it on the second pass but the package, containing eye glasses for a passenger and other paraphernalia, fell into the sea.
